Transaction 50688706038cecfba048d660c1d280e119e01a60f52d9077346ba2c8f00f4e2a
1 Input
1 Output
-
50688706038cecfba048d660c1d280e119e01a60f52d9077346ba2c8f00f4e2a:0
- value
- 88120552
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9bd5a553b12e0c89fe50b8975148870b17cc1ec3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FCyg75G2ZyCAYm5k9Y6pXXBqKGSS5FKVa